mind·set or mind-set M0310300 (mīnd′sĕt′)n.1. A fixed mental attitude or disposition that predetermines a person's responses to and interpretations of situations.2. An inclination or a habit.ThesaurusNoun | 1. | mindset - a habitual or characteristic mental attitude that determines how you will interpret and respond to situationsmentality, mind-set, outlookattitude, mental attitude - a complex mental state involving beliefs and feelings and values and dispositions to act in certain ways; "he had the attitude that work was fun" |
